Summary
Roman meets with Khalil at the Carruthers home to update him on the long con against the Gilchrist brothers. Roman explains he's already extracted significant money through the inflated demolition contracts on Skids properties, paid Mayor Gravely his cut, and is set to meet the BBB's mysterious supplier. Khalil offers to hit an upcoming gun shipment from Roanoke and frame it on the Rare Breed motorcycle club to ratchet up pressure on Torrent. Roman, recalling that Torrent's people put his father in a vegetative state, tells Khalil to do whatever is necessary, even if men die.
At the Osman Hotel, Roman, Torrent, and Tranquil are taken up to a private rooftop bar to meet a man called Shade, an immaculately dressed power broker who reveals he is not the BBB's partner but their boss, having helped raise Torrent and Tranquil after their father Horace was incarcerated. Shade hires Roman to launder money for a corrupt Virginia Department of Emergency Management official who owes Shade's loan sharks gambling debts. Shade demands a fifty-percent return on seven-figure sums within three months, with implicit lethal consequences for failure. Roman accepts.
Walking back to the cars, Roman feigns ignorance and asks Torrent who Shade is. Torrent identifies him and bitterly notes that Shade, like the devil, has no friends.
Returning home, Roman finds Dante drinking and despondent because Tug's girlfriend Raynell has worsened. Dante drops a bombshell: Cassidy has contacted him asking to come home. Roman insists Cassidy must stay away because the BBB believe she is dead, and her return would expose the lies and get the entire family killed. Dante, fragile and guilt-ridden over the mounting body count, asks if Roman would hurt her; Roman swears he wouldn't but cannot vouch for Torrent and Tranquil. Dante promises to talk to her but insists they must protect her if she shows up.
Roman's assistant Keisha calls about a client, Lil Glock, who has been swindled out of four million dollars in a real estate scam. Roman heads to his father's place to handle it. Unseen, Chauncey sits in a parked sedan down the street, photographing Roman, his Challenger, and the license plate.
